An Efficient Clustering Algorithm on Next-Generation Sequence Data

  • Manan Kumar Gupta,
  • Soumen Kumar Pati

摘要

The clustering algorithms are an unsupervised machine learning methodology widely utilized in various fields to find and identify patterns in data. In bioinformatics, clustering plays a crucial role that primarily helps to find relations between similar gene sequences. In this work, a new clustering technique has been proposed that uses the concept of tensors, Riemannian manifolds, and geodesics to cluster a given set of biological data. This new method of clustering Next-Generation Sequence data has been developed keeping in mind that it should yield previously undetected patterns in such type of data. The proposed work is compared with well-known clustering techniques such as k-means, DBSCAN, hierarchical and fuzzy c-means clustering algorithms via several metrics (DB index, Dunn index, Rand score, and Silhouette score) and shows its efficiency.
